Is Michael Cera Finally On Board for Arrested Development Film?

Michael Cera

Break out the frozen bananas! The final piece to the Arrested Development puzzle has been put into place.

Michael Cera has reportedly agreed to sign on to the film project after being the only cast holdout for several weeks, according to attorney Bob Loblaw (just kidding! E! Online told us). The rest of the cast — Jason Bateman, Portia de Rossi, Will Arnett, Tony Hale, Jessica Walter, Jeffrey Tambor and David Cross — have already signed on, a source close to the film's negotiations said.

The movie adaptation of the critically acclaimed-and-audience-deprived Fox series, which may hit theaters as early as this fall, will reportedly be written by series creator Mitchell Hurwitz and directed by Ron Howard (who narrated the TV show).
